Thursday, January 28, 2016 - Deep ruby, borderline purple in the glass. The nose is jam filled with hints of dark cherry, coffee and just a little wet stone and smoke. The palate hits with fresh, young fruit and those wonderful Margaux style crushed flowers. The wine is medium bodied and surprisingly well integrated. The finish is medium/long and migrates satisfyingly from front to back of palate. Very successful wine for the vintage.
